Antibiotic Resistance Profile of Lactic Acid Bacteria Origine From Animal Foods
Öz
At the present time, researches about lactic acid bacteria have begun to increase. This situation enable that investigate of starter culture features on these microorganisms. On the other hand, using antibiotic for growth promoter on animals cause development antibiotic resistance in these microorganisms. While researches about multiple antibiotic resistance of pathogen microorganisms increase, microorganisms that safety for public health begin to acquire antibiotic resistance. In this review, it is aimed to give some information about antibiotic resistance of lactic acid bacteria.
